Epupa Falls is known for its setting on the Kunene River. Omarunga Epupa-Falls Camp lists a guided walk upstream along the river. The walk lasts about 2 hours and costs N$465 per person, although the same listing also displays N$445. The listed validity period runs from 1 November 2026 to 31 October 2027. [1]
Omarunga Epupa-Falls Camp also highlights vervet monkeys and birdwatching along the route. This makes the activity a simple choice for visitors who want a guided experience without committing to a full multi-day safari. Departure is listed as on request. [1]

The Kunene Camino runs from below Ruacana Falls to Epupa Falls. The route combines formal campsites with wild camping, creating a more immersive wilderness journey. [2] This option suits hikers who want the journey itself to be the main experience, rather than a short visit to the falls.

Opuwo to Epupa is the key road approach described in the supplied tour information. The drive takes about 3 hours because the route includes river crossings or dips and winding roads. [6] Travelers should therefore allow extra time for road conditions, stops, and changes in speed.
Road travel works well for a Namibia self drive safari. It gives you more control over stops and route timing. A guided vehicle offers more support, while a self-drive plan requires you to manage fuel, navigation, road conditions, and accommodation bookings yourself.
Ruacana to Epupa is a longer route that follows the Kunene River westward. Bluerhino Safaris schedules the section for 24–25 March 2027. The route passes through traditional Himba territory, where the Himba have lived as a semi-nomadic culture. [3]
The Kunene Camino offers a related walking concept. It starts below Ruacana Falls and ends at Epupa Falls. Formal campsites and wild camping form part of the route. [2] Ask an operator about walking distance, porter support, meals, water, and camp equipment before booking.
A listed flying safari includes Epupa Falls, lasts 10 days, and is marketed for June to October. Its price guide starts at US$26,505 per person. [7] This is the clearest match for travelers searching for “safari namibia luxus” and wanting a high-end trip with less time spent on remote roads.
Responsible Travel lists a Namibia departure on 4 July 2027 at US$7,797 per person, excluding flights. The supplied listing marks the departure as available. [8] The itinerary details and Epupa Falls inclusions should be confirmed before payment.

Epupa Falls Lodge lists five raised river-view rooms. Each room sleeps two people. The 2027 chalet rate starts at N$2,600 for a single room. [4] Epupa Camp lists a 2027 single-tent rate of N$3,580 per person for stays from 1 November 2026 to 31 October 2027. [5]
Price range: Use N$465 as the listed starting point for a guided activity, N$2,600 for a single lodge chalet, N$3,580 for a single tent, and US$26,505 for the listed 10-day flying safari. Ask whether meals, transfers, park fees, guides, and flights are included.

Epupa Falls Lodge is a lodge option with five raised river-view rooms. Each room sleeps two people, and the 2027 single chalet rate starts at N$2,600. [4] This setup suits travelers who want a private room and a river setting after a long road day.
Epupa Camp is a tented accommodation choice. Its listed single-tent price is N$3,580 per person for the 2027 rate period. [5] Confirm the sharing rate, meal plan, room setup, and activity schedule before booking because these details affect your final cost.
March 24–25, 2027 is the scheduled date for Bluerhino Safaris’ Ruacana-to-Epupa section. [3] June to October is the stated ideal period for the listed flying safari. [7] These dates do not guarantee availability for every operator, so request written confirmation before arranging flights.
Opuwo to Epupa is a three-hour drive under the listed route description. [6] Build your day around daylight, road conditions, and planned stops. A self-drive safari should also include a clear return plan and confirmed accommodation.

The Ruacana-to-Epupa route passes through traditional Himba territory. [3] Treat community visits as cultural exchanges, not staged photo stops. Ask your guide about permission, photography, dress, gifts, and local customs before meeting residents.
River walks also need care. Stay with your guide, follow the marked route, and protect the river environment. Omarunga highlights birdwatching and vervet monkeys, so quiet walking can improve the experience. [1]
